She
graduated in with a Bachelors degree in Journalism with honors from the
Institut des Médias de Paris (ISCPA). Mariana just finished a MSc in Violence,
Conflict and Development at SOAS University of the University of London. During
college she began working for several media organisations such as El Universal,
RFI, Cadena SER and Monocle. Her interests focus around social and human rights
stories. Most recently, she has reported on the border conflict between
Venezuela and Colombia.
